The UASI Process includes is a comprehensive threat, vulnerability, capability, and needs assessment, which will be used to develop a Homeland Security Strategy for the Urban Area. All Hands will assist the City in performance of the work required to complete these processes. The assessment will address terrorism threats, vulnerabilities, and response capabilities for the entire Miami, Miami - Dade County, and Broward County geographical area. Time is of the essence as this assessment must be completed by September 30, 2003. To facilitate the data collection process, All Hands will assist in conducting facilitated workshops to assist jurisdictions with the assessment. This workshop will facilitate the collection of current baseline capabilities and assist jurisdictions in determining desired capabilities based on various scenarios.
